How Good Are Circuit Breakers in Avoiding House Fires?
Electrical wiring, cords, and plugs, switches, and outlets can cause massive damage to your property or your family. According to the Electrical Safety Foundation International (ESFI), home electrical fires account for an estimated 51,000 fires each year.
